The 71 and 72 Pontiac shop manuals do not have the master cylinder codes listed like the previous years. If the '71-'72 application requires the power disc Delco-Moraine master cylinder, the Pontiac Master Parts Catalog lists 5471802 for all A,B,& G power disc Moraine. This number is also in the Oldsmobile MPC for the F85 & has a stamped code of "BE".
